This revision of the PKCS#7 S/MIME handling series is based on (and
very similar to) the series sent on the thread starting at
id:20200430201328.725651-1-dkg@fifthhorseman.net
However, it is rebased after more gracefully handling the subtle
errors in X.509 certificate validity when built against older versions
of GMime.
In particular, the patch found at
id:20200512222010.371054-1-dkg@fifthhorseman.net must be applied
before this series can be applied.
